The Packaging Of Olay Beauty Fluid....

Firstly the box is light pink and dark pink with a picture of the bottle on the front of it. On one side of the box it gives beauty tips. On the back it tells us why the moisturiser is right for us and how it works. On the other side of the tells us how to use it and ingredients.

The bottle is a 100ml recyclable. On the front simple branding and on the back tells us again, how to use it. It has a black screw on lid doesn't look anything special just classic.

So The Lotion.....

The one I use is the non-greasy moisturising fluid for sensitive skin. I did use the lotion for normal skin but I found it harsh and it made my eyes water and this doesn't. This lotion is white and doesn't smell. It isn't runny but it does spread easily. As you rub it into your face you can feel the water content in it. When it's on the face you can't feel it at all and it doesn't feel one bit greasy. I use it all the time, under my make up first thing in the morning, whenever I want to it as it never upsets my skin at all.

The Tips On The Box...

Mix a little Olay Beauty Fluid with your liquid foundation base. It will not only help you get the coverage you want, you'll also get the moisturising and soothing benefits that beauty fluid brings with it.
After a day in the sun, apply Beauty fluid, which is hydrating, but so light and absorbent that you are left with silky soft skin.
Massage a few drops of Beauty Fluid every time you wash your hands and before you know it they will feel moisturised and velvety smooth.

Overall....

This is another product I'd never be without. As soon as I apply it I feel my skin loves me! It's one of the only products that I feel is truly kind and doesn't annoy my skin. Not once have I broken out in spots (which I'm very prone to). I always use a moisturiser under my make up and it never feels greasy or gives me problems. I suffer with dry eyes and fragranced products gives me the burn where as this if I accidently get a little bit in my eye I can simply wipe it away without any sign of tears.

There are many other Olay products, in fact so many ranges its too confusing. I've tried them and I like them but I cant see how they are any better. I'm ageing fairly well, am not covered in wrinkly skin and do have a healthy glow about me and I do think Olay can take some of the credit for that.
